This lovely bungalow is located in the quiet town of Herndon, Kansas. It features a classic bungalow front porch that faces east for the morning sun and afternoon shade. Inside you'll find two bedrooms and a large bathroom plus the living/dining room combo next to the kitchen. Just beyond the kitchen is the back porch/mudroom with the washer and dryer. The basement has one non-conforming bedroom and the remainder of the space is unfinished. The furnace and air conditioner appear to have been upgraded in recent years. Step outside the back door and enjoy the wooden deck built around a beautiful evergreen tree. A single car garage sits off the alley. This home is ready for a new start with you.
